Delayed Ejaculation

Delayed ejaculation refers to the prolonged time it takes to reach ejaculation despite adequate sexual stimulation and desire. This condition can result from psychological issues, medical conditions, medication side effects, or lifestyle factors. Identifying the root cause is crucial for effective treatment.
